The nubank-authorizer
is a micro-service designed to register account and transactions.
The service is consumed via the api interface, using json to traffic the payload objects.
Verb | URI | Action |
---|---|---|
POST | /accounts |
Create an account |
POST | /transactions |
New transaction |
The project design follows the clean code principle with SOLID concepts. The directory layout follows the golang-standards/project-layout with some adaptations to make the project simpler, like go.

To create a newaccount send a post to /accounts
, for example:
$ curl -X POST http://localhost:3000/accounts \
-d '{"account": {"activeCard": true, "availableLimit": 100}}'
To register a new transactions send a post to /transactions
, like:
$ curl -X POST http://localhost:3000/transactions \
-d '{"transaction": {"merchant": "ifood", "amount": 25, "time": "2020-12-22T10:00:00.000Z"}}'
# create an account
$ curl -X POST http://localhost:3000/accounts \
-d '{"account": {"activeCard": true, "availableLimit": 100}}'
{"account":{"activeCard":true,"availableLimit":100},"violations":[]}
# account-already-initialized rule
$ curl -X POST http://localhost:3000/accounts \
-d '{"account": {"activeCard": true, "availableLimit": 350}}'
{"account":{"activeCard":true,"availableLimit":100},"violations":["account-already-initialized"]}
# create an transaction
$ curl -X POST http://localhost:3000/transactions \
-d '{"transaction": {"merchant": "Burger King", "amount": 20, "time": "2019-02-13T10:00:00.000Z"}}'
{"account":{"activeCard":true,"availableLimit":80},"violations":[]}
# doubled transaction rule
$ curl -X POST http://localhost:3000/transactions \
-d '{"transaction": {"merchant": "Burger King", "amount": 20, "time": "2019-02-13T10:02:00.000Z"}}'
{"account":{"activeCard":true,"availableLimit":80},"violations":["doubled-transaction"]}
# insuficient limit rule
$ curl -X POST http://localhost:3000/transactions \
-d '{"transaction": {"merchant": "Burger King", "amount": 200, "time": "2019-02-13T10:00:00.000Z"}}'
{"account":{"activeCard":true,"availableLimit":80},"violations":["insufficient-limit"]}
